In the demo, there are: changing the color of the site, day and night mode, changing the screen colors, but these are not available when we buy them.

Thank you for your purchase. Please note that the React and NextJs versions are different. The NextJs version already includes all modes, while the React version will have modes added in future updates.

You can check the demo links for both versions below the description. In the “Change Log” section, we have clearly mentioned that the modes are available in the NextJs version.

I am not a website developer, so please excuse my ignorance. My websites have all been simple html which I have edited using Expression Web, Coffee Cup etc. I need to know before purchasing if I am able to customize a eCommerce React NextJs Template with Expression Web or Coffee Cup wysiwyg editors?

Working with React (or more specifically Next.js) integrated into tools like Expression Web or Coffee Cup is a bit cumbersome, as such tools are focused on developing static websites and are used with HTML, CSS, and even a little JavaScript sometimes. They are not adequately equipped for today’s web development cycles, particularly for frameworks such as React or Next.js that call for Node.js, build step, and server-side rendering support that they inherently lack.
